President Trump said on Friday that he had expected the war in Iran to cause a bigger hit to stock markets.

"I thought we were going to go down more," he said. He added, "and I thought oil prices were going to go up higher." The S&P 500 is down for a fifth straight week to its lowest levels since August.

Trump made the comments at the FII Priority Summit in Miami Beach, while discussing the war, now nearing the month mark.
